What Is Dry Ice Cleansing?



Solidified carbon dioxide cleansing, likewise recognized as carbon dioxide cleaning, is a cutting-edge technique that utilizes solid carbon dioxide pellets to eliminate pollutants from numerous surfaces. This strategy functions by accelerating solidified carbon dioxide pellets via a nozzle, developing a powerful jet that blasts away dirt, oil, and various other unwanted materials. You'll locate it effective on a vast array of surfaces, consisting of steel, wood, and also delicate electronic devices.


One of the most effective parts? It doesn't leave any type of deposit since the completely dry ice sublimates directly right into gas upon contact with the surface. You will not require to worry regarding water damages or chemical residues, making it eco-friendly. Plus, completely dry ice cleaning is quick and effective, allowing you to bring back surface areas without lengthy downtime. Whether you're keeping equipment or preparing surface areas for paint, this method can conserve you time and hassle, making it a go-to option in modern surface area restoration.


The Science Behind Solidified Carbon Dioxide Cleaning





Using the concepts of thermodynamics and kinetic power, solidified carbon dioxide cleansing effectively gets rid of pollutants from surface areas. When you spray solidified carbon dioxide pellets onto a surface, they quickly sublimate, transforming from strong to gas. This process produces a remarkable decrease in temperature level, triggering contaminants to become fragile and loosen their bond with the surface area.




As the pellets influence the surface area, they move kinetic power, properly removing dust, grease, and various other unwanted materials. The carbon dioxide gas generated throughout sublimation expands and develops small shockwaves, additionally aiding in the removal of these contaminants.


This cleaning technique is non-abrasive and leaves no residue behind, making it suitable for fragile surface areas. You do not need to fret about rough chemicals or water damage, as solidified carbon dioxide cleaning is both efficient and eco friendly. By comprehending this scientific research, you can appreciate how solidified carbon dioxide cleaning offers an unique option for surface area reconstruction.

Environmental Impact Comparison



Solidified carbon dioxide cleaning not only masters effectiveness however additionally stands apart for its environmental benefits contrasted to typical approaches. Unlike chemical cleansers and solvents that often release harmful VOCs, solidified carbon dioxide cleansing utilizes strong carbon dioxide, which sublimates right into safe gas. This suggests you're minimizing air contamination and promoting healthier offices. And also, there's no requirement for water, so you'll preserve this important resource while removing the danger of water damage. Traditional methods can create waste, however completely dry ice cleansing decreases byproducts, making disposal much easier and extra environment-friendly. By choosing this ingenious method, you're not just recovering surface areas; you're additionally sustaining sustainable methods that safeguard our earth for future generations. Historical Reconstruction Jobs



Commercial devices upkeep showcases the versatility of solidified carbon dioxide cleaning, which also plays a significant function in historical reconstruction jobs. When you're charged with protecting age-old frameworks or artefacts, you need non-invasive and efficient methods. Dry ice cleansing enables you to get rid of dirt, grime, and organic development without harming the underlying products.


With dry ice, you can clean delicate rock, timber, or steel without the danger of abrasion. In historic repair, completely dry ice cleansing is a game-changer, merging performance with preservation.
